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
- Compatibility: Confirm standard hose thread sizes (NH, 3/4 inch GHT) and faucet type to ensure a proper seal and fit with your existing hoses and accessories.
- Material and durability: Brass fittings tend to last longer and resist corrosion, especially in outdoor exposure. Plastic options are typically lighter and cost-effective but may wear faster.
- Locking and sealing mechanisms: Quick-connect systems should offer secure locking to prevent accidental disconnection, plus reliable washers or gaskets to avoid leaks under pressure.
- Ease of use: Look for ergonomic grips, swivel joints, and smooth rotation to minimize strain during attachment and disconnection, especially in larger lawn setups.
- Leak prevention: Consider kits with built-in shut-off valves or automatic disconnect features to reduce water waste and splashing when swapping accessories.
- Versatility: If you manage multiple watering tools (sprinklers, nozzles, spray guns), modular quick-connects with broad compatibility simplify transitions between accessories.
- Maintenance: Check that washers are replacable and that components are easy to clean to maintain a reliable seal and fluid flow over time.
When selecting a garden hose to tap connector, balance durability, compatibility, and ease of use with your typical watering tasks. For high-frequency use and harsh outdoor conditions, brass or solid-metal connectors with secure locking mechanisms tend to offer the best long-term value. For occasional tasks or renters, a universal or plastic quick-connect may provide adequate performance at a lower upfront cost.
